The object is controlled by a parameter list of \s-1RGBA\s0 values both for addition and multiplication. All of them are optional, but could be set later via \fIsetColorAdd()\fR and \fIsetColorMult()\fR methods. Default values for the xAdd parameters are 0, and for xMult defaults are 1.
